Château Méaume Reserve du Château
Bordeaux Superieur

2006 (in wooden cases)

Alan Johnson-Hill only makes the Reserve du Château at Château Méaume in really good years—it is the pick of his crop and is aged in second year barrels bought from the legendary Le Pin in Pomerol. This is a very good Claret from the sumptiously ripe 2006 vintage. Exceptional value for money—and in wooden case.

Our tasting notes
Dark, brooding full red in colour with rich berry fruit and cedar flavours. Good concentration and lush Merlot fruit. Drinking really well now. Great dinner party Claret.
Wine data
Grape variety: 85% Merlot, 10% Cabernet Sauvignon and 5% Cabernet Franc
AOC: Bordeaux
Alcohol: 13%
About Château Méaume
Château Méaume lies just north of Pomerol and has been the home of Alan and Sue Johnson-Hill and countless animals since the early 1980's. Everything is done by hand and their wines are organic in all but name—the only fertlizers used is the manure from their cows etc. Their achievement in making really good quality Reds and a first rate Rosé that sell for far below what they should is now legendary.
